Athletics outfielder Henry Bolte opened the 2026 season at Triple-A and dominated, hitting .348 with 12 home runs and 17 stolen bases across 177 plate appearances. The 22-year-old's strong performance earned him a promotion to the big leagues in mid-May. Bolte has maintained his impressive production since being called up, hitting .315/.400/.414 with two home runs, 10 RBI, 11 runs scored, and eight stolen bases across 130 plate appearances in the big leagues. Bolte's elevated 28.5% strikeout rate is a bit of a concern, and his 5.3% barrel rate does not suggest high-end power upside. However, Bolte's elite speed and his 50% hard-hit rate should allow him to continue to run a high batting average on balls in play. If he can ever learn to elevate the ball a bit more (63.2% ground ball rate), Bolte's power could take off as well. In leagues where he's not already rostered, Bolte profiles as a must-add outfielder ahead of a potential breakout season.--Will Brady
